Atlas Orthogonal Reviews: Is This Gentle Chiropractic Worth Trying?

Atlas Orthogonal reviews often highlight precise, gentle adjustments that target neck alignment without cracking or twisting. Many patients describe reduced stiffness and improved daily function after a series of visits with an Atlas Orthogonal specialist.

This overview presents structured details on Atlas Orthogonal technique reviews, appointment experience, and safety data. You can use these insights to compare this approach with other manual therapies for neck and headache concerns.

How Atlas Orthogonal Technique Differs

Atlas Orthogonal reviews frequently emphasize the use of a precision instrument rather than manual thrust. The method aims to influence atlas position with a soft impulse along the mastoid process, which many patients find less intimidating than high-velocity adjustments.

Clinicians typically review posture, cervical alignment, and symptom patterns before recommending imaging for verification. This systematic screening supports a more targeted approach to upper cervical care, which is central in many Atlas Orthogonal reviews.

Safety and Contraindication Considerations

Reviewers commonly note that Atlas Orthogonal may suit people who prefer minimal-force options. Pre-screening helps identify situations where imaging and specialist referral are advised before proceeding with adjustments.

Providers usually discuss potential risks in detailed consultations, reinforcing that safety depends on accurate assessment and individualized planning. Headache, dizziness, and neck pain patterns are evaluated carefully to guide next steps.

What to Expect During Follow-Up Visits

Subsequent visits often focus on progress tracking and technique refinement. Many Atlas Orthogonal reviews mention that small adjustments over time can lead to more stable neck function and fewer acute symptoms.

Some practices incorporate posture re-education and coordination with other therapies, such as stretching or manual work in different regions. Keeping records of symptom changes between sessions helps both patient and clinician gauge effectiveness.

FAQ

Reader questions

Does Atlas Orthogonal involve any cracking or popping sounds?

No, the technique uses a gentle instrument impulse and typically does not produce cracking or popping noises.

How soon can I expect relief from neck pain or headaches after starting Atlas Orthogonal care?

Relief timing varies; some notice subtle improvements within a few visits, while others require a longer care plan for consistent change.

Will I need X-rays or imaging as part of the Atlas Orthogonal evaluation?

Yes, most providers require specific images to assess atlas position before and sometimes after care to ensure precision.

Are there any restrictions on activities after an Atlas Orthogonal adjustment?

Providers usually recommend avoiding heavy strain immediately after an adjustment and gradually returning to normal activities as comfort allows.
